html,body,
h1,h2,h3,h4{
  font-family: 'Crimson Text', serif!important;
}
html,body,.t3-wrapper {
  background-color:#FFEC9F!important;
  font-size:18px!important;
}

a {
  color:#000;
}

a:hover {
  color:#900;
}

div.logo-text a {
  color:#856BB4;
}

h2.page-subtitle {
  color:#856BB4;
  
}

h2.article-title a {
  font-size:24px;
}

.btn-primary {
    background-color: #856BB4;
}
.btn-primary:hover {
    background-color: #900;
}

.article-aside {
    color: #999999;
    font-size: 16px;
    margin-bottom: 10px;
    margin-top: -10px;
}

.navbar-default {
  background-color:#FFE377;
  border-color:#FFE377;
}

.page-subheader {
    border-bottom: 1px solid #FFE377;
    margin: 0 0 20px;
}

.navbar-default .navbar-nav > li > a {
    color: #000;
}

.nav > li > a:hover, .nav > li > a:focus {
    text-decoration: none;
    background-color: #FFE377;
}

.navbar-default .navbar-nav > .active > a, .navbar-default .navbar-nav > .active > a:hover, .navbar-default .navbar-nav > .active > a:focus {
    color: #900;
    background-color: #FFEC9F;
}

.page-header {
    border-bottom: 1px solid #FFE377;
}
.t3-copyright {
    border-top: 1px solid #FFE377;
    font-size: 12px;
    padding: 10px 0 10px;
}

.t3-footer {
    border-top: 1px solid #FFE377;
    background: #FFEC9F;
    color: #000;
}
.t3-navhelper {
    background: #FFE377;
    border-top: 1px solid #FFE377;
    color: #000;
    padding: 5px 0;
}
.breadcrumb {
    background-color: transparent;
}
.btn-default {
  color: #FFF;
  background-color: #856BB4;
  border-color: #856BB4;
  font-size: 16px;
}

.btn-default:hover {
  color: #FFF;
  background-color: #900;
  border-color: #900;
}
.module-title {
    margin-bottom: 20px;
    margin-top: 10px;
    font-style: italic;
}

.items-leading .leading {
    margin-bottom: 20px;
    border-bottom: 1px solid #FFE377;
    padding-bottom: 20px;
}

.t3-off-canvas {
    background: #FFEC9F;
    color: #000;
}
.t3-off-canvas .t3-off-canvas-header h2 {
    margin: 0;
    line-height: 35px;
    font-size: 18px;
    font-weight: bold;
    text-transform: uppercase;
}
.t3-off-canvas .t3-off-canvas-header {
    background: #FFE377;
    color: #856BB4;
    padding: 0 0 0 12px;
    height: 35px;
}
.t3-off-canvas .t3-off-canvas-body a {
    color: #000;
    text-decoration: none;
}
.t3-off-canvas .t3-off-canvas-body a:hover {
    color: #900;
    text-decoration: none;
}
.dropdown-menu > li > a:hover, .dropdown-menu > li > a:focus {
    color: #900;
    text-decoration: none;
    background-color: #FFE377;
}
.nav-pills > li.active > a, .nav-pills > li.active > a:hover, .nav-pills > li.active > a:focus {
    background-color: #FFE377;
}
.nav-pills > li.active > a, .nav-pills > li.active > a:hover, .nav-pills > li.active > a:focus {
    color: #000;
}
.dropdown-menu {
  background-color: transparent;
}
.breadcrumb > .active {
    color: #000;
}
.pull-right img {
  padding-left:20px;
}

.formResponsive input[type="text"], .formResponsive input[type="number"], .formResponsive input[type="email"], .formResponsive input[type="tel"], .formResponsive input[type="url"], .formResponsive input[type="password"] {
    width: 90%;
    height: 30px;
}
.formResponsive textarea {
    width: 90%;
    height: 100px;
}

.formResponsive input[type="submit"],
.formResponsive button[type="submit"] {
    background-color: #856BB4!important;
    background-image: none!important;
    background-repeat: none!important;
    border-color: transparent!important;
    filter: none!important;
    color: #ffffff!important;
    text-shadow: none!important;
  font-size:16px;
}

.formResponsive input[type="submit"]:hover,
.formResponsive button[type="submit"]:hover,
.formResponsive input[type="submit"]:active,
.formResponsive button[type="submit"]:active,
.formResponsive input[type="submit"].active,
.formResponsive button[type="submit"].active,
.formResponsive input[type="submit"].disabled,
.formResponsive button[type="submit"].disabled,
.formResponsive input[type="submit"][disabled],
.formResponsive button[type="submit"][disabled] {
    background-color: #900!important;
    color: #ffffff!important;
    text-shadow: none!important;
}
html.itemid-146 img {
  border:3px solid #FFF;
}
html.itemid-146 h3 {
    margin-top: 5px;
    margin-bottom: 30px;
    font-weight:bold;
}
.dropdown-menu {
  background-color:#FFE377!important;
}